Embodiment 1

[0011] Take the preparation of 1 liter of cobalt-nickel-phosphorus-silicon carbide composite plating solution as an example, put 45 grams of sodium citrate and 15 grams of lactic acid in the container, add 1000 milliliters of deionized water in the container, stir until dissolved; then add 1 Add 1 g of cobalt sulfate, 120 g of nickel sulfate, and 5 g of phosphorous acid into the container, and stir evenly until dissolved at room temperature; then heat the above-prepared solution to 65°C with a water bath, and then add 1 g of Stir the methylhexynol evenly until it dissolves; then add 10 grams of sodium bicarbonate to adjust the pH of the solution to 2; finally add 10 grams of silicon carbide and stir until it dissolves to complete the preparation of the electroplating solution.

Abstract

The invention relates to a cobalt nickel phosphorus-silicon carbide electroplating solution and an electroplating method, and solves the technical problems of high brittleness, poor wear resistance, low electrodeposition speed, and existence of microcracks in the surface and holes after plating in the existing electroplated tungsten alloy. The electroplating solution contains the following components in parts by weight: 1000 parts of deionized water, 1-5 parts of cobaltous sulfate, 120-180 parts of nickel sulfate, 5-20 parts of phosphorous acid, 10-40 parts of silicon carbide, 45-75 parts of sodium citrate, 15-25 parts of lactic acid, 1-2 parts of saccharin and 0.2-0.6 part of dimethyl hexynol. The invention also relates to an electroplating method. The electroplating solution and electroplating method can be widely used for surface treatment of metal workpieces.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to an electroplating solution and an electroplating method, in particular to a cobalt nickel phosphorus-silicon carbide electroplating solution and an electroplating method. Background technique [0002] In the field of petroleum machinery technology, eccentric wear and corrosion are relatively serious. For the surface treatment process of petroleum machinery, there is currently no surface treatment technology that is both anti-corrosion and wear-resistant and low-cost. With the continuous consumption of petroleum resources, the environment for oil exploitation is getting worse and worse, and the requirements for corrosion resistance and friction resistance of petroleum equipment are also getting higher and higher. Therefore, developing an anti-corrosion and wear-resistant surface treatment technology has always been a subject of research by those skilled in the art.
